Kauai, Hawaii’s oldest island, open to the public, boasts more beaches per mile, the most botanical gardens, the wettest patch of jungle in the world and many other features that set it apart from its gorgeous, famous neighbors. It stands out as the vacation destination of choice, blending the enchantment of ancient Hawaii with all modern conveniences. Kayak on the same river where Indiana Jones escaped, or windsurf with playful spinner dolphins swimming at your side. Enjoy a whalewatching expedition, or explore exquisite waterfalls on a scenic helicopter tour, or from a zodiac craft. Sportfishing, scuba diving, and snorkeling are all popular in the pristine waters off the incomparable coasts. Horseback riding offers breathtaking vistas from the mountains to the beaches.
As islands go, Kauai is not especially large. But the ramparts of its northwest coastline are so huge and so magnificent that even seasoned visitors continue to be in awe of their scale and beauty. Rivaling any coastline in the world for grandeur, Kauai’s Napali Coast is a rugged 17-mile stretch of sheer 3,000-foot cliffs (napali means “the cliffs”), lush green valleys, free-flowing waterfalls and secret sea caves. Rich in legends and myths and protected as Hawaii’s last true wilderness where no road or car will likely ever lead, the Napali Coast can only be seen by foot, air or sea, from which visitors can experience some of the most memorable scenery on earth.
Activities & Attractions:
CAPTAIN COOK'S LANDING - located at Waimea Bay, this was the first place in which the intrepid British explorer Captain James Cook set foot in Hawaii in January, 1778.
HANALEI VALLEY - with a lookout point that is home to one of the most famous views of the island and a beach consistently ranked among the best in the world, this is a must for all travelers.
HANAPEPE VALLEY - see the rolling red cliffs stand out amongst the valley's myriad shades of green and blue. You may also recognize the valley at the setting for Steven Spielberg’s famous Jurassic Park.
KALALAU LOOKOUT - one of the most photographed valleys in all of Hawaii, it holds one of the most beautiful views on earth. The Kalalau Valley is the largest valley on Kauai.
KILAUEA LIGHTHOUSE & KILAUEA POINT NATIONAL WILDLIFE REFUGE - a refuge for nesting seabirds, the isolated promontory where the lighthouse sits is open to visitors.
KOKEE STATE PARK - adjacent to Waimea Canyon this park has picnic grounds, cabins and a wide variety of outdoor activities including hunting, trout fishing and hiking. The NASA Kokee Tracking Station is located nearby.
LUMAHAI BEACH - chosen for Nurses' Beach in South Pacific, this lovely spot is undoubtedly the most photographed beach on Kauai.
OPAEKAA FALLS - the Wailua River makes a dramatic plunge over a high clif. Opaekaa means "rolling shrimp" and dates from days when swarms of shrimp were seen rolling in turbulent waters at the base of the falls.
SMITH'S TROPICAL PARADISE - this 23-acre site has gardens, lagoons, exotic birds and unique narrated train ride which meanders through a rain forest, a Polynesian village, a Japanese island, a Filipino village and other interesting areas. Kauai's ethnic heritage is reflected nightly in a 75-minute musical production in the lagoon theater.
WAILUA FALLS - nicknamed Fantasy Island Waterfalls.
WAIMEA CANYON - this is more than a view, it's an experience! You'll treasure in memory its grandeur and jewel-tone colors, its awesome depth and breadth.
